Anyway, on to the matter at hand and that is the ever revolving world of the Halo movie.

The trouble with the Halo movie is we, the gamers and Microsoft and Bungie all have really high expectations, rightly so BUT when it comes to movie studios, well, they just want to bang one out.

I’ve been through all of this before so won’t go over it again. However, I will let you know that good news may well be piling up at Halo Movie’s door.

Here I’ll hand over to our regular film info buddies firstshowing.net to give you some interesting details which may ease those Halo movie fears.

“Whoa, wait, when did this happen?! Our friends at IESB are reporting a considerably exciting rumor that Steven Spielberg has taken over development on the Halo movie that Peter Jackson previously tried to make. They're saying they've confirmed this "with studio executives and our close ties to CAA" and that it's legit.

Let's not forget that Jackson and Spielberg are working together on Tintin, so they've probably had plenty of time to talk about bringing one of the greatest video games in history to the big screen. But why is Jackson letting Spielberg take over so easily? Is it because he doesn't have time with The Hobbit coming up?

Apparently Spielberg took a look at the script that Stuart Beattie had written in his free time (remember this concept art?) for a Halo movie titled Halo: Fall of Reach and was "blown away" by it. Other connections between Spielberg and Beattie are that they're both repped by the talent agency CAA. And then there's the little fact that Spielberg was a special guest during Microsoft's E3 presentation for their new Project Natal (watch that video) and still reps it on their website.

Oh yea and during that presentation, Spielberg even said he was a big gamer (if we can believe that). So all the pieces are there, maybe this does all make sense?

I'm one of those people who believes that a Halo movie could be (and deserves to be) as epic, exciting, and legendary as the game itself still is. And obviously it will take a lot of time and money to pull something like that off, as well as a creative team that is second to none.

Peter Jackson was the first big step in the right direction, but then all of that fell apart. Now if it's true that Spielberg has stepped up instead, he couldn't be a more acceptable alternative and one of only a few that I would trust handling a franchise like this. And with that, I hope all this turns out true, because I'd love to see a Spielberg Halo movie. What about you?”
